Algeria national team coach Vladimir Petkovic has backed goalkeeper Luca Zidane after his weak World Cup start against Argentina. “Everyone has the right to make mistakes. I am very convinced of his abilities,” the 62-year-old said. Zidane, son of football legend Zinédine Zidane, was particularly in the spotlight of criticism after the 3-0 defeat with three goals conceded from Lionel Messi.
When asked about the public criticism of Zidane, Petkovic reacted calmly. “I don’t read anything. I don’t have any social media accounts,” he said.
Before the second group match against Jordan on Tuesday (05:00, ZDF and MagentaTV), there is also uncertainty about striker Mohamed Amoura from Wolfsburg. “I can’t confirm that yet. We still have one training session and I can only say something about that tomorrow,” said Petkovic. Both teams have zero points after the first round.
